Motorized Pallet Truck
The Walkie-Rider, Walkie or Rider is a Motorized Pallet Truck that is essentially a motorized type of a pallet jack. They are available in both "Rider" versions and "Walkie" models.
Like what the name implies, the walkie type is designed for the operator to walk along with the unit while they transport loads. The Rider model on the other hand, uses a small platform for which the operator stands on. The rider models are great for frequent moving of cargo over extended distances in manufacturing operations and warehouses. They are highly fast and maneuverable.
It is vital to remember that there is no safety cage on this model and hence, it is not recommended to transport unstable or tall loads utilizing these machines. A rider can be the perfect answer if you are looking for an inexpensive way of transporting loads from point A to point B. If though, you should move heavy loads short distances, and prefer to use a more employee-friendly unit rather than a pallet jack, the walkie model could be the right choice.
Order Selector
An Order Selector also goes by the name of Order picker. This machinery is particularly made for manual handling of less-than-pallet-load quantities in racking. There are fixed forks connected to a platform in the Man-up design. This particular platform elevates both the load and the operator with a purpose to facilitate manual loading and unloading from racking areas.
Order Selectors are usually very narrow aisle vehicles that could operate in aisles of less than six feet. They are very handy pieces of machine during cycle counting situations as well as during physical inventories. Order selectors are available in lift heights up to 40 feet high, though models that range in the 20 to 30 foot range are a lot more popular.
